Transaction 59e05474087a20c8110bca05cd91df951133a1c49e9506cffc74332c76e08f14
1 Input
1 Output
-
59e05474087a20c8110bca05cd91df951133a1c49e9506cffc74332c76e08f14:0
- value
- 167800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95f1977ba376a1987b1bc7b5f13fca72fd983593 OP_EQUAL
- address
- 3FMr2DNnXjRAQhTxjyxtLuo5weEL4UwqT6